Understanding Business Insurance Options
Business insurance is a broad term encompassing several types of coverage designed to safeguard businesses against various risks. Here are some of the essential insurance policies that businesses should consider:
1. General Liability Insurance
General liability insurance protects a business from claims of bodily injury, property damage, and advertising injuries caused by the business's operations or products.
2. Professional Liability Insurance
Professional liability insurance, also known as errors and omissions (E&O) insurance, covers claims of negligence, malpractice, or misrepresentation in the services your business provides.
3. Property Insurance
Property insurance covers damage to your business property, including your building and the contents within it, from perils like fire, theft, and natural disasters.
4. Workers' Compensation Insurance
This type of insurance provides benefits to employees injured on the job, covering med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ation costs.
5. Business Interruption Insurance
Business interruption insurance compensates a business for lost income during periods when it cannot carry out business as usual due to an insured disaster.
6. Cyber Liability Insurance
Cyber liability insurance is increasingly important as businesses rely more on technology. It covers losses related to data breaches, cyberattacks, and other digital threats.
Benefits of Comparing Business Insurance Policies
Cost Savings: By comparing different insurance offers, businesses can find the most affordable policy that doesn't sacrifice necessary coverage. Insurance premiums can vary widely, and without proper comparison, companies may overpay for their insurance.
Tailored Coverage: Every business is unique, with specific risks based on factors such as industry, size, and location. Comparing policies allows businesses to tailor their coverage to match their particular needs.
Informed Decisions: Understanding the nuances between various policies and insurance providers empowers business owners to make informed decisions. Policy terms, coverage limits, deductibles, and exclusions can significantly impact the effectiveness of your insurance.
Peace of Mind: Knowing that your business is properly insured provides peace of mind. In the event of an unforeseen issue, comprehensive coverage means you can focus on running your business rather than worrying about financial ruin.
How to Get Started with Comparing Business Insurance
To begin the process of comparing business insurance policies, follow these steps:
-
Assess Your Needs: Identify the types of risks your business faces and the level of coverage needed to protect against them. Consider the value of your assets, the nature of your business operations, and any regulatory insurance requirements.
-
Get Quotes: Gather quotes from multiple insurance providers. Many insurers offer online quote tools that can provide preliminary estimates based on your business details.
-
Read the Fine Print: Carefully review policy details from each insurer, paying attention to coverage limits, deductibles, exclusions, and any additional endorsements that may be beneficial.
-
Consult with Professionals: Speak with insurance agents, brokers, or other business advisors to get their opinions on the best insurance options for your needs.
-
Reassess Regularly: As your business grows or changes, your insurance needs may also evolve. Periodically reassess your coverage to ensure it remains adequate.
